Mr Wallace I have a question ❓. I saw your total body conditioning video. but i noticed that you don't do squats or lunges. Is it detrimental for kicking?
Those exercises are great for developing strength BUT they also increase the mass of your legs and that was something that would decrease my speed. Keep in mind that your leg is almost a third of your total weight and so I prefer to keep mine light and quick. Great question!

The lateral splits are the most important for side kicks, round kicks and hook kicks - my favorite kicks. The front splits are for your hamstrings and are used more for front kicks, axe kicks, etc. So, they are important for those kicks but again with my system I do not use them. Great question!
